Tips for Responsible Use

A credit card is a powerful tool when used responsibly. Students can set themselves up for financial success by following simple habits:

  • Pay on time: Make at least the minimum payment by the due date to avoid late fees and preserve credit health.
  • Pay in full when possible: Avoid carrying a balance to minimize interest costs and keep debt manageable.
  • Keep utilization low: Aim to use a small percentage of your available credit to demonstrate responsible borrowing.
  • Monitor statements: Review monthly statements and transaction alerts to catch errors or unauthorized activity quickly.
  • Create a budget: Track income and expenses to ensure credit use fits within your financial plan.

Frequently Asked Questions

Who can apply for the Student Credit Card?

Eligible applicants are typically enrolled students aged 18 or older who can provide proof of enrollment and demonstrate a source of income or financial support.

Will using this card help me build credit?

Yes. Responsible use—making on-time payments and maintaining low balances—can help establish and improve your credit history as the account activity is reported to credit bureaus.

Are there rewards or benefits for students?

Some card variants may include rewards or cashback categories geared toward student spending. Specific reward structures vary by card and are detailed in the card’s terms and disclosures.

What happens if I miss a payment?

Late payments may result in fees and could negatively affect your credit score. If you are having trouble making a payment, contact customer support to discuss available options and avoid long-term consequences.
